NASA Administrator Bill Nelson will give the 2022 State of NASA address at 2 p.m. EDT on Monday, March 28, from NASAs Kennedy Space Center in Florida. The event will air live on NASA Television, the NASA app, and the agencys website.

Nelson will highlight NASAs plans to explore the Moon andMars, address climate change, promote racial and economic equity, and drive economic growth while sustaining U.S. leadership in aviation and aerospace innovation.

Following the State of NASA, Associate Administrator Bob Cabana and Chief Financial Officer Margaret Vo Schaus will host a virtual media teleconference at 4:30 p.m. to discuss the Biden-Harris Administrations fiscal year 2023 funding request for the agency. Joining them for questions and answers are senior leaders from each of NASAs mission directorates.

Audio from the budget briefing will stream live on NASAs website.
